Openapi 生成器:是否可以从自动生成的代码参数中排除一些 headers?
Openapi generator: is it possible to exclude some headers from auto generated code parameters?
我想支持一些 "infrastructural" headers 并用它们来描述我的 api 但是,在生成阶段,我不希望那些 headers在代码中显示为参数。
我会通过拦截器等特定手段来处理它们。
这可能吗?
最后我不得不编写一个自定义小胡子模板并定义我的供应商扩展。以下是可能有所帮助的片段:
{{#vendorExtensions.x-custom}}
,@ApiImplicitParam(name = "param", value = "First param", required=false, dataType = "Integer", paramType = "header")
{{/vendorExtensions.x-custom}}
我想支持一些 "infrastructural" headers 并用它们来描述我的 api 但是,在生成阶段,我不希望那些 headers在代码中显示为参数。 我会通过拦截器等特定手段来处理它们。
这可能吗?
最后我不得不编写一个自定义小胡子模板并定义我的供应商扩展。以下是可能有所帮助的片段:
{{#vendorExtensions.x-custom}}
,@ApiImplicitParam(name = "param", value = "First param", required=false, dataType = "Integer", paramType = "header")
{{/vendorExtensions.x-custom}}